How what is md5 technology can Save You Time, Stress, and Money.
How what is md5 technology can Save You Time, Stress, and Money.
Blog Article
It ought to be described that MD5 isn't fantastic and is also, in fact, regarded for being liable to hash collisions. Hash collisions arise when various parts of data develop the identical hash benefit, undermining the theory that every special piece of data need to produce a uniquely identifiable hash end result.
The process includes padding, dividing into blocks, initializing inside variables, and iterating through compression features on Just about every block to generate the final hash price.
As being a cryptographic hash, it has identified safety vulnerabilities, like a significant opportunity for collisions, which is when two distinct messages end up with the same generated hash value. MD5 can be successfully used for non-cryptographic capabilities, together with like a checksum to confirm info integrity towards unintentional corruption. MD5 is really a 128-bit algorithm. Despite having its recognised stability difficulties, it stays The most typically made use of information-digest algorithms.
Despite its speed and simplicity, the safety flaws in MD5 have brought about its gradual deprecation, with more secure options like SHA-256 being recommended for purposes the place info integrity and authenticity are essential.
Assistance us improve. Share your ideas to boost the write-up. Contribute your knowledge and produce a big difference while in the GeeksforGeeks portal.
Greatly enhance the short article with the skills. Lead towards the GeeksforGeeks Group and enable generate far better Studying resources for all.
Unfold the loveAs someone that is simply beginning a company or making an attempt to determine an experienced identity, it’s imperative that you have a typical enterprise card at hand out. A company ...
The top hashing algorithm is determined by your needs. Certain cryptographic hash capabilities are Utilized in password storage to ensure that simple textual content passwords are hashed and held safer within the party of the information breach.
Irrespective of its previous popularity, the MD5 hashing algorithm is now not deemed protected as a consequence of its vulnerability to various here collision assaults. Therefore, it is recommended to implement more secure cryptographic hash capabilities like SHA-256 or SHA-3.
Passwords stored applying md5 could be conveniently cracked by hackers making use of these procedures. It is recommended to employ more powerful cryptographic hash capabilities, such as SHA-256 or bcrypt, for password storage.
Greg is actually a technologist and details geek with more than ten years in tech. He has labored in many different industries as an IT manager and software package tester. Greg is an avid writer on almost everything IT similar, from cyber security to troubleshooting. A lot more through the creator
The MD5 algorithm, Inspite of its attractiveness, has both of those pros and cons that influence its suitability for numerous applications. Comprehending these advantages and disadvantages is essential for identifying when and in which MD5 can nevertheless be successfully utilized.
MD5 will work by breaking up the input facts into blocks, and after that iterating in excess of Each and every block to use a number of mathematical operations to create an output that is exclusive for that block. These outputs are then combined and even more processed to generate the final digest.
With this area, we will prevent going into your details, and instead address the components of MD5 that make up its development like a cryptographic hashing algorithm.